Output 24d255500595a6ae779ab1ce3014a481a1f411e847ca2f839584dae2c5b0cab8:3

value
468811
script pubkey
OP_0 OP_PUSHBYTES_20 b3ba9a49cdc16e76db49607eb15a7360131718a9
address
bc1qkwaf5jwdc9h8dk6fvpltzknnvqf3wx9fcalfjm
transaction
24d255500595a6ae779ab1ce3014a481a1f411e847ca2f839584dae2c5b0cab8